Ten years ago, captivated viewers followed the drama of a 6-year-old Colorado boy who reportedly had floated away in a balloon. But when it landed, he wasn't there.
Fort Collins ColoradoanFORT COLLINS, Colo. – Like a sequence out of a comic book, a silver floating disc swept across Colorado's dusty plains on a clear October afternoon.
"If you'd stay here, I'd like to see the kid get out," someone told the helicopter pilot as 9News filmed first responders rushing to the scene. They attacked the still-inflated balloon with pitchforks and pocket knives, clawing to get inside.In this Oct. 15, 2009 file photo, six-year-old Falcon Heene is shown with his father, Richard, outside the family's home in Fort Collins, Colo., after Falcon Heene was found hiding in a box in a space above the garage.
"That's the great thing about this case. I don't have to describe it to anyone," said Hughes, who covered the hoax as a Coloradoan reporter in 2009 and 2010. Hughes cut his lecture short, ran out the door and jumped in his car. He drove southeast across Northern Colorado for what felt like a couple of hours, trying to get eyes on the balloon.
After seeing some coverage on TV, Alderden sped back to Fort Collins. Standing before the hordes of reporters that had gathered in the Heenes' neighborhood, Alderden laid out what he knew during a press conference. In the middle of it, he got word that Falcon had been found. In 2008, the Heenes had been featured on ABC's reality show"Wife Swap," where wildly different families switched matriarchs for two weeks.
